Output 15f5251eb406b522590a20d33a5919795a5bc872a8a4ab05428553c50a23b33f:14

value
150989
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 464890ba541e2f40fbfdf701a1b796dd981e00b5 OP_EQUALVERIFY OP_CHECKSIG
address
17QdEMgUadQLhFvcrSJbfm8KViyjeK3Sk2
transaction
15f5251eb406b522590a20d33a5919795a5bc872a8a4ab05428553c50a23b33f
spent
true